The fifth hole, a par four dogleg right, is an unexpected delight.
Because you can’t see the green from the tee, you’re not prepared
for the breathtaking approach over a beautiful water management
pond.
Keep your drive to the left of the fairway, where
theres a nice landing area for your second shot over the
pond. If you try to cut off too much of the dogleg, you may find
yourself punching out on your next shot.
The "carry" over the pond is about 100 yards. Once you arrive over the water, the green is large
and inviting, with a distinct back-to-front slope towards the front
bunker.
